Plot the following points:

a. 3,7
b. -4,5

To plot the given points on a graph, follow these steps:

1. Draw a coordinate plane with an x-axis (horizontal) and a y-axis (vertical).
2. Locate the point (3, 7) on the graph. Start at the origin, which is the point (0, 0). Move 3 units to the right on the x-axis and then go up 7 units on the y-axis. Place a dot at the intersection of these coordinates.
3. Locate the point (-4, 5) on the graph. Start at the origin again. This time, move 4 units to the left on the x-axis and then go up 5 units on the y-axis. Place a dot at the intersection of these coordinates.
